South African defender Vanes-Mari du Toit would love to play for the Steel next season.

And a comment on a social website last week indicated she had started negotiations with the franchise.

But the athletic 23-year-old was keen to set the record straight when contacted for comment yesterday.

"I just want to clarify things," she told the Otago Daily Times from Wellington.

"There has been a lot of speculation and rumours going around. What I can say to you is they have asked me for my contact details and that is all I can say at this stage."

Her post on Twitter was very misleading, then.

Responding to suggestions she had signed with the Steel, du Toit wrote "Nothing confirmed yet, but negotiations are underway (sic)".

However, both parties seem very keen to reach terms. Du Toit wants to play ANZ Championship netball and the Steel is looking for a defender of her calibre.

"It is a dream and something I would love to do. Netball is a passion and I do it because I love it. I don't do it because of all the extras. Getting the opportunity to improve my game and play alongside some of the best in the world is an opportunity which is more than I would ever expect."

The South African team is in Wellington for the New Zealand leg of the quad series.
